End Mill Selection: Materials, Coatings, and Geometry

Picking the suitable end cutter involves thorough consideration of several factors: material type , coating application , and design. Varying materials, such as rapid steel, cemented carbide, and integral tungsten , offer different levels of hardness and erosion resistance. Coatings – including AlTiN, AlCr nitride, and amorphous carbon – provide superior outside finish, minimized friction, and boosted cutting longevity. In conclusion, the end geometry—including groove count, spiral , and rake angle—significantly influences chip removal and surface quality.

Optimizing Cutting Operations with the Appropriate Fixture

Selecting the right tool holder here is essential for improving machining operations and gaining high precision. A poorly fixture can lead to vibration, reduced longevity, and poor part accuracy. Assess factors such as machine stability, spindle taper type (e.g. CAT), holding forces, and the cutting tool being employed. In addition, using a vibration-dampened tool holder can greatly reduce oscillation and improve overall performance.
